About the Role
Korn Ferry Interim has partnered with a global technology and software organization seeking a Contract-to-Hire Payroll Specialist to support payroll operations across North America. This is a hands-on role for a payroll professional who is passionate about payroll as a career, thrives in a fast-paced environment, and enjoys owning the payroll process from start to finish. The ideal candidate will have strong experience managing complex multi-state U.S. and Canadian payrolls, partnering with employees and cross-functional teams, and ensuring compliance with payroll tax and labor regulations. This position offers the opportunity to join a collaborative global payroll team with long-term growth potential.
Key Responsibilities
- Process end-to-end bi-weekly payroll for U.S. and Canadian employees, including hourly and salaried populations.
- Ensure payroll accuracy through data validation, audits, reconciliations, and exception reporting.
- Administer payroll-related activities including: Garnishments, Tax withholdings, Benefit deductions, Time and attendance processing, Overtime and FLSA calculations.
- Serve as a primary point of contact for employee payroll inquiries and issue resolution.
- Maintain and audit payroll data within HRIS and payroll systems.
- Review and reconcile payroll tax filings, W-2s, and payroll-related reports.
- Support internal and external audits and ensure compliance with federal, state, provincial, and local regulations.
- Partner with HR, Accounting, Finance, and third-party payroll vendors to resolve issues and improve processes.
- Prepare payroll-related reporting including general ledger files, accruals, headcount reporting, and ad hoc analyses.
- Assist with payroll process improvements, controls, documentation, and training initiatives.
- Support payroll operations across multiple North American entities and collaborate with the broader global payroll team.
